Output 59594a9f38f69eb6bef5c931fd40e7b1d26dafd5cdac322c40d62af6e76115ea:1

value
19348346
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ddee0a6a6b8b621dd8451577945b47de6e57037c OP_EQUALVERIFY OP_CHECKSIG
address
1METVkabAd8GY9jAfZuCzroZPPYjB1F9f7
transaction
59594a9f38f69eb6bef5c931fd40e7b1d26dafd5cdac322c40d62af6e76115ea
spent
true